Based on the concept and approach of BEC System, four biogeoclimatic zones were identified in Hokkaido Island, Japan. They were: 1) Subalpine Pinus pumila zone, 2) Montane Abies sachalinensis zone, 3) Nemoral Acer mono zone, and 4) Nemoral Fagus crenata zone. Ecological characteristics of the zones were briefly discussed. A map showing the geogroaphical range of the zones was provided.
